Dallas-Fort Worth Commercial Real Estate Foreclosures Rise More Than 25 Percent

There were 2,431 Dallas- Fort Worth commercial real estate foreclosures in 2009, that’s up from 1,900 commercial foreclosures in 2008.

The biggest rise in commercial foreclosure filings in 2009 was in postings for office – up 121 percent – and retail buildings, up 20 percent.  Foreclosure filings for commercial land also increased by 71 percent compared with 2008. Apartments were near the top of the list …

Dallas-Fort Worth Foreclosures Skyrocket

More than 42,000 Dallas-Fort Worth area homes have gone on the foreclosure auction block since January 2008, up more than 35% from 2007, according to the Dallas Morning News. This is a new record for Dallas-Fort Worth. But despite the rise in foreclosures, the market remains unstable with only 40% of the homes being sold after they go to auction.

Dallas-Fort Worth’s Sales Tax Collections Dip Lower

October’s reports on declining sales tax revenues have shown that the state of Texas is still suffering from consumer spending contractions.  Sales tax revenue has declined a full 15 percent statewide, 17 percent in Fort Worth with Dallas fairing a little better at a 5.3 percent decline.  An unrelenting string of job losses, elevated long-term unemployment and increased vulnerability to foreclosure have caused many consumers to spend more cautiously than many …
